BITTER, BOTHERED AND BEYOND Comes to Renberg Theatre in April
by Stephi Wild - Mar 3, 2022


The Los Angeles LGBT Center's Lily Tomlin/Jane Wagner Cultural Arts Center has announced the return of the legendary Miss Coco Peru in her new solo show, Bitter, Bothered & Beyond. There will be three performances only at the Renberg Theatre on Friday and Saturday, April 29 and 30, at 8pm, and Sunday, May 1, at 7pm.

Coco Peru to Present BITTER BOTHERED & BEYOND at Birdland
by Chloe Rabinowitz - Mar 2, 2022


BIRDLAND will present drag legend Coco Peru in the new show “Bitter Bothered & Beyond!” for two special performances. The first show at Birdland Jazz Club on Monday, March 21 at 7:00 PM quickly sold out, so an encore performance has been added for Tuesday, March 22 at 8:30 PM downstairs at the Birdland Theater.

Act II Playhouse Stages Production of BUYER AND CELLAR
by Marissa Tomeo - Feb 20, 2022


Act II Playhouse in Ambler, PA announces their latest stage production, Buyer and Cellar, written by Jonathan Tolins, directed by Tony Braithwaite and starring Zachary Chiero. The show runs from March 1 through April 2.
